Pwc need a Blogger(6 months Project-based)
Position/job title: Blogger(6 months Project-based)– Staff/Senior Staff - Beijing
Grade: Staff/Senior Staff
Location: Beijing
Type: 6 Month Contract
Requirements:
• University degree holder in English or journalism (or related background), preferably with a masters degree in communications/media relations
• Must be an effective communicator and be able to synthesize complex and diverse materials into information that PwC constituents will find engaging and compelling
• Confidence to deal with Senior Leadership within the firm
• An understanding of electronic communications and ability to use them effectively to reach a broad and targeted audience
• A good example of our target audience, focused on generation Y
• Excellent written and verbal English and Chinese.
Job Description & Responsibilities:
Our Assurance practice has been going through an exciting cultural change programme where we are focusing on ‘interaction and communication’ up and down the organisation. As part of our internal efforts to adopt some breakthrough behaviours within the firm – we require an individual to work with the Assurance Human Capital Director, Assurance Leader and broader team to manage our internal online blog. This individual will be editing the blog by addressing key questions and content from our staff sent through both online and offline channels on a weekly basis. This individual will be delivering high quality services to our internal clients, and the ability to communicate and administer activities to the maximum efficiency will be an asset. Key responsibilities include;
• Assess questions, comments and suggestions from our staff within the assurance practice on a weekly basis, to determine action and follow up with key stakeholders.
• Draft content in English and Chinese by working together with the “Blog Editorial team” and leadership
• Develop key themes and focal points with key leaders on an ongoing basis
• Developing strategy and thinking to ensure the blog becomes a dynamic environment to engage our staff on a continuous basis.
• Work closely with our Marketing & Communications and our Technology Teams to ensure we can keep content and technology vibrant on an weekly and monthly basis
• Work with advocates within the Business Units as part of sourcing content and framing issues and dialogue with our people
• Frequent engagement with leadership and key stakeholders to agree and sign off content
• Manage and update a project plan
This position is project based with 6 months contract.
Reporting structure & key relationships:
Reporting: to the Assurance Human Capital Director & Blog Editorial Team

About PricewaterhouseCoopers - Globally
PricewaterhouseCoopers provides industry-focused assurance, tax and advisory services to build public trust and enhance value for its clients and their stakeholders. More than 155,000 people in 153 countries across our network share their thinking, experience and solutions to develop fresh perspectives and practical advice.
"PricewaterhouseCoopers" refers to the network of member firms of PricewaterhouseCoopers International Limited, each of which is a separate and independent legal entity.
About PricewaterhouseCoopers - China, Hong Kong, Singapore and Taiwan
PricewaterhouseCoopers China, Hong Kong, Singapore and Taiwan work together on a collaborative basis, subject to local applicable laws. Collectively, we have more than 580 partners and a strength of 14,000 people.
